DESCRIPTION: | No. 70344 |
Mineral: | Fluorite |
Locality: | Xianghualing Mine, 32 km north of Linwu, Hunan Province, China |
Description: | Highly transparent (you can see straight through the fluorite to the bottom) green fluorite crystals with no matrix. The fluorite crystals are cubic form, with lustrous cubic faces and textured dodecahedral edge faces composed of smaller crystal faces. Collected ca. 2000 |
Overall Size: | 10x9x4.5 cm |
Crystals: | 30-62 mm |
